2011 Jeep Liberty review
I have the Limited model 2X2 (loaded otherwise) and bought from my brother who’s daughter had since new, currently has 119,000 miles. After detailing the vehicle which didn’t take as much time as I normally would on a 8 year old car to bring it to my cosmetic standards, I realized that this vehicle’s exterior paint quality is impressive for being Black color as well as other styling components being well made. I admired the vehicle after I put 8 solid hours into it and said to myself “What a kick xxx looking Jeep” - Yes you need to push the gas pedal a bit more just to get it moving from a stand still in a parking lot as an example, but come on, it’s 5,000 pounds and all muscle. When I first took it out on the road, I could immediately feel the the solid all around quality of the suspension. I really like the thick leather wrapped steering wheel. The “Infinity” entertainment system along with the Touch Screen is an all around great system and very responsive with no lag when using the touch screen. The sound quality is incredible and the factory Sub Wofer mounted in the rear gives you the sense of being in a dance club. I do my own general maintenance and this Jeep is real easy to work on. I’ve read that the Transmission can go out around 100,000 miles but my brother has done regular service 2X previously and I just did it when I took possession at 119,000 miles. The leather seats are poor quality but I use Maguire's products to keep the seat surfaces from abnormal cracking and so far they are holding up. The dash has a small screen to scroll through different parts of the vehicle’s status like tire pressure on all wheels, etc.. The designers/engineers spent a lot of time on building a solid vehicle. It’s not a Toyota and you have to expect a higher repair rate, but if you keep on top of important general & regular maintenance, you will have a higher rate of reliability. I only use Mobil 1 Oil and Mobil 1 Oil Filters which is the most critical service of any vehicle.

What is the MPG of the 2011 Jeep Liberty?
The 2011 Jeep Liberty offers up to 16 MPG in city driving and 22 MPG on the highway for a combined rating of 18 MPG.
These figures are based on EPA mileage ratings and are for comparison purposes only. The actual mileage will vary depending on the selected vehicle trim, driving conditions, driving habits, vehicle maintenance, and other factors.
